Commentary | The Basque lady, accompanied by one of her damsels and other companion, all knelt, begs don Quixote not to hurt her squire (lying defeated and half-dead in the background).
Don Quixote's figure is victorious and clement; see his gesture. Remarkable drawing and engraving; notice some excellent details, such as the lady's dress, shading... |
Notes | 1 - Same copy after Gilbert's illustration (London: Charles Daly, 1842 and London: Bohn, 1842) first published in London: Appleton, 1853. |
